《兼容性检查器:从原理到应用的探索》
兼容性检查器,这个在现代技术领域中逐渐崭露头角的工具,似乎正以其独特的方式影响着各个行业的发展。它究竟是如何工作的?又在哪些方面发挥着重要作用呢?让我们一起来深入探讨一下。
一、兼容性检查器的基本原理
兼容性检查器,从名字上看,它的主要任务就是检查不同系统、软件或设备之间的兼容性问题。也许我们可以把它想象成一个媒人,在各种不同的“对象”之间进行匹配和检查,看它们是否能够和谐共处。
它的工作原理可能是通过对不同系统或软件的底层代码进行分析和对比。就好像是一个侦探,仔细地寻找着那些可能导致兼容性问题的“蛛丝马迹”。它会检查各种参数、接口、协议等方面的差异,以确定它们是否能够相互理解和交互。
例如,在不同版本的操作系统之间进行兼容性检查时,它可能会检查文件系统的结构、驱动程序的兼容性、应用程序的接口等方面。如果发现了差异或不匹配的地方,就会发出警报或提示,告知用户可能存在的兼容性问题。
二、兼容性检查器在软件开发中的应用
在软件开发过程中,兼容性检查器发挥着至关重要的作用。它可以帮助开发人员提前发现和解决潜在的兼容性问题,从而提高软件的质量和稳定性。
我觉得,就像是建筑工人在建造房屋之前,需要进行详细的规划和检查一样,软件开发人员在开发软件之前,也需要使用兼容性检查器来确保软件能够在不同的环境中正常运行。
比如,当开发一个跨平台的应用程序时,兼容性检查器可以帮助开发人员检查在不同操作系统(如Windows、Mac和Linux)上的兼容性。它可以测试应用程序在不同分辨率、不同浏览器版本等情况下的表现,及时发现并修复可能出现的问题。
兼容性检查器还可以用于测试软件在不同硬件设备上的兼容性。例如,对于一款游戏软件,它需要在各种不同配置的电脑上都能够流畅运行。兼容性检查器可以模拟不同的硬件环境,测试游戏在这些环境中的性能和兼容性,确保玩家能够获得良好的游戏体验。
三、兼容性检查器在系统集成中的作用
在系统集成过程中,兼容性检查器也是不可或缺的工具。当将不同的系统或软件集成在一起时,可能会出现各种兼容性问题,如接口不匹配、数据格式不一致等。
兼容性检查器可以帮助系统集成人员快速定位和解决这些兼容性问题,避免因为兼容性问题而导致系统集成失败。它可以对集成后的系统进行全面的兼容性测试,检查各个组件之间的交互是否正常,数据传输是否准确等。
比如说,在企业信息化建设中,需要将不同的业务系统集成在一起,形成一个统一的信息平台。此时,兼容性检查器就可以发挥重要作用,确保各个业务系统之间能够无缝对接,数据能够顺畅流动。
四、兼容性检查器面临的挑战与未来发展
尽管兼容性检查器在各个领域都有着广泛的应用,但它也面临着一些挑战。
一方面,随着技术的不断发展和更新换代,新的系统、软件和设备不断涌现,兼容性检查器需要不断更新和升级,以适应这些变化。这就需要投入大量的人力和物力进行研发和维护。
另一方面,兼容性问题往往非常复杂,有时候很难准确地定位和解决。就像一个迷宫,我们需要不断地探索和尝试,才能找到正确的路径。而且,不同的兼容性问题可能需要不同的解决方案,这就增加了兼容性检查器的开发难度。
不过,我觉得随着技术的不断进步,兼容性检查器也将不断发展和完善。也许未来的兼容性检查器将更加智能化,能够自动学习和适应各种不同的环境和情况,更加准确地检测和解决兼容性问题。

同时,随着云计算、大数据等技术的发展,兼容性检查器也将与这些技术相结合,实现更加高效、便捷的兼容性测试和管理。
五、兼容性检查器的实际案例与效果
为了更好地理解兼容性检查器的作用和效果,我们来看几个实际案例。
在某大型企业的信息化建设项目中,使用了兼容性检查器对不同业务系统的集成进行了测试。结果发现了一些接口不匹配的问题,通过及时调整和修复,确保了系统的顺利集成,提高了工作效率。
在一款智能手机的开发过程中,兼容性检查器帮助开发人员发现了在不同网络环境下的兼容性问题,并进行了优化。使得该手机在各种网络环境下都能够稳定运行,受到了用户的好评。
这些实际案例表明,兼容性检查器确实能够有效地发现和解决兼容性问题,提高系统的稳定性和可靠性,为企业和用户带来实实在在的好处。
六、如何选择合适的兼容性检查器
在选择兼容性检查器时,我们需要考虑多个因素。
要根据自己的需求和应用场景来选择。如果是在软件开发中使用,需要选择能够满足软件开发流程和要求的兼容性检查器;如果是在系统集成中使用,需要选择能够针对系统集成特点进行测试的兼容性检查器。
要考虑兼容性检查器的功能和性能。它应该能够覆盖各种常见的兼容性问题,并且测试速度快、准确性高。
还要考虑兼容性检查器的易用性和维护成本。一个易于使用的兼容性检查器可以提高工作效率,而较低的维护成本则可以节省企业的资源。
总之,选择合适的兼容性检查器需要综合考虑多个因素,根据自己的实际情况做出选择。
兼容性检查器作为现代技术领域中的一个重要工具,正在逐渐发挥着越来越重要的作用。它通过对不同系统、软件或设备之间的兼容性进行检查,帮助用户提前发现和解决潜在的问题,提高系统的稳定性和可靠性。虽然它面临着一些挑战,但随着技术的不断发展,它也将不断完善和进步。相信在未来的发展中,兼容性检查器将在各个领域发挥更加重要的作用,为我们的生活和工作带来更多的便利。
本文来自投稿,不代表展天博客立场,如若转载,请注明出处:https://www.me900.com/526513.html